About me
I believe that each person is the expert of their life. I also believe that at times we all need an objective person to listen and to help us find our center. I strive to meet each person where they are, with no judgments, no preconceived ideas. I believe that counseling is not about labeling problems, it is about developing coping skills, gaining self-awareness, and self-understanding. Together we find ways to uncover your strengths and live a more meaningful life.
Using CBT (Cognitive Behavioral Therapy) and ACT (Acceptance and Commitment Therapy) I work with the client to notice how their thoughts and feelings impact their behavior, as well as create new ways of behaving that will move the client closer to their values and goals.
I am currently focused on addressing issues of anxiety and depression with adolescents, and adults. I enjoy mindfulness training, stress reduction techniques, and coping skills development.
